Output 3029cc84d99e49508f1e003dd35e4757faaf887c1668e20bca6ede43c3c9721b:1

value
3629058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3eb033e3c57e7223453333ca3bff639146d438c1 OP_EQUAL
address
MDcdD6qhuyYRekCGvGj9bdMYhKaCXj8YP7
transaction
3029cc84d99e49508f1e003dd35e4757faaf887c1668e20bca6ede43c3c9721b
spent
true